Stick with the chicken and seafood. Skip on the sides. Lol. Hush puppies were hush puppies. Nothing special about the, but not bad. Roll was your basic roll. Red beans and rice were not for me, I didn't enjoy it. The gumbo was TERRIBLE. Worst Gumbo I jave ever had in my whole entire life, worse than every boxed Gumbo I have tried. Grandmas rolling over in her grave, genuinely insulted by that they are calling that gumbo. It looked off putting too. You know how they say you eat with your eyes first? My eyes are starved. Looked like dark goo. Picked out the 2 peices of shrimp and trashed it. The egg roll was straight trash, mushy and disgusting, just dont do it. However, the fried shrimp saved everything! (5 pc) IT WAS SO GOOD. Crispy, tasted fresh, I was surprised in comparison. I probably won't be back, but If I do, know it's for the seafood. The prices are good though, I'll give them that.

I have been going to this place for years and they continue to keep the good food coming. I usually get their red snapper (which is amazing) but I’ve been reading reviews about the jumbo shrimp and I tried those with their fish combo (I got catfish). The jumbo shrimp is really good, cooked well, good flavor. The catfish was good as well but it wasn’t as good as the red snapper. There’s always a bit of a wait here, but it’s work it. Only downside is the parking. The lot gets full fast and the street does too, so good luck. Calling in the order may help with the wait if the line isn’t busy. Either way, you won’t regret the trip.

I recently visited Louisiana Fried Fish and Chicken on Myrtle, and I must say that I was extremely disappointed with my experience. My concerns revolve around the lack of sanitary practices and the unpleasant behavior of the manager.

Firstly, I was troubled to notice that the workers were not wearing gloves while preparing the food. This is a basic hygiene practice that should be followed in any food establishment. Witnessing multiple workers handling food without gloves raised serious concerns about potential cross-contamination.

Furthermore, proper handwashing procedures seemed to be neglected. I observed three workers washing their hands with water only, without using soap. This is simply unacceptable in terms of ensuring food safety and preventing the spread of bacteria.

To make matters worse, I noticed a worker grabbing fish and scallops from the front refrigerator without wearing gloves. This blatant disregard for food handling practices is a clear violation of basic hygiene standards.

Additionally, I found the attitude of the manager to be highly unpleasant. When I respectfully expressed my concerns and requested a refund due to the sanitary issues, the manager responded with a fit of anger. This kind of unprofessional behavior is not only unwarranted but also reflects poorly on the establishment as a whole.

As a customer, I believe it is crucial for food establishments to prioritize the health and safety of their patrons. Unfortunately, my experience at Louisiana Fried Fish and Chicken has left me seriously concerned about the overall cleanliness and hygiene practices of the establishment.

I strongly urge the management to address these issues promptly and take the necessary steps to ensure that proper sanitary practices are implemented. Customers should be able to dine in a safe and clean environment without worrying about potential food contamination.

Based on my experience, I cannot recommend Louisiana Fried Fish and Chicken on Myrtle. It is my hope that this review serves as constructive feedback and prompts necessary improvements in the future.
